Why it is easy to cut with a sharp knife than blunt one?

Sharp knife-edge has smaller area than a blunt one. When the force is applied on the knife, the sharp edged knife produces more pressure on the surface and gets penetrated into the surface.
Thus, it is easy to cut with a sharp knife than blunt one.

Why does a siphon not work in vacuum?

The functioning of siphon is based on the atmospheric pressure. On sucking, the pressure of the air inside the siphon decreases and the atmospheric pressure on the liquid outside pushes the liquid up in the siphon. If there is vaccum, i.e., there is no atmospheric pressure, then there is no force on the liquid that can push the liquid into the siphon and siphon does not work.

Explain why water cannot be used in place of mercury in a barometer?


The atmospheric pressure at sea level = 76cm of Hg = 1.013x10Pascal. 

If we fill the water in barometer tube, the height of water column required to balance the atmospheric pressure will be,

   h =Atmospheric PressureDensity of water×acceleration due to gravity   =1.013×1051000×9.81   =10.326m 

That is, if water is used in barometer tube instead of mercury, the length of the tube must be greater than 10.326 cm. A greater height will be difficult to hold in a vertical position and needs a high tower to install the barometer. 

So, we cannot replace mercury by water in the barometer.

What do you mean by absolute pressure and gauge pressure?

Absolute pressure is the pressure above that of vacuum. 

Absolute pressure = Gauge pressure + One atmospheric pressure.

Gauge pressure is the pressure above that of one atmospheric pressure. Since the pressure of vacuum is zero, it is referenced against an ambient air pressure.

Note: Atmospheric pressure is the pressure at any point equal to the weight of a column of air of unit cross-sectional area extending from that point to the top of the atmosphere.

Why are paper pins and nails made to have pointed ends?

Pointed paper pins or nails have small area as compared to the blunt one. Lesser the area, greater is the force applied. When force is applied on the pins, they exert large pressure on the surface and hence easily pierce the surface and get penetrated into it.
